SUS304 Snake Bone Thread Rings – Precision Attachment Rings for Endoscope Articulation Control
The SUS304 Snake Bone Thread Rings are specialized components designed for the assembly and maintenance of flexible endoscope articulation sections. These rings, crafted from medical-grade SUS304 stainless steel, serve as secure attachment points for control threads (wires) that enable precise bending and maneuverability in the snake bone structure. Utilizing advanced laser micromachining, they ensure smooth integration, high durability, and minimal tissue interaction, making them essential for reliable performance in endoscopic procedures without compromising safety or functionality.

Medical-grade SUS304 stainless steel (austenitic chromium-nickel alloy), offering excellent corrosion resistance and mechanical properties.
- التوافق الحيوي: Low risk of allergic reactions or toxicity, ideal for direct tissue contact in medical procedures.
- Mechanical Properties: High tensile strength (approximately 505 MPa) and elongation (up to 40%), providing flexibility without brittleness.
- Surface Finish: Laser-machined for smooth, burr-free edges, reducing the potential for tissue trauma or contamination.
- Thermal Stability: Maintains integrity across a wide temperature range, suitable for sterilization processes like autoclaving.
- Endoscope Assembly: Used to attach control threads in the snake bone section for precise articulation in gastroscopes, colonoscopes, and bronchoscopes.
- Endoscope Repair and Maintenance: Essential for replacing or upgrading rings in damaged articulation mechanisms to restore functionality.
- Minimally Invasive Procedures: Supports reliable bending and navigation in anorectal, gastrointestinal, and other endoscopic interventions.
- Medical Device Manufacturing: Integrated into production of flexible endoscopes requiring high-precision control wire attachments.
- Custom Endoscope Designs: Adaptable for specialized or investigational endoscopes needing enhanced articulation control.
